Ebonyi votes N16b for farmers, civil servants

Ebonyi state governor David Umahi has set aside N16  billion to farmers to access this fiscal year including civil servants and other interesting individuals.

Umahi noted that the fund which were split into N8b marked for other investment would also be accessed through loan.

He added that the funds were sourced from Bank of Industry (BOI)and Centre Bank of Nigeria (CBN).

Umahi spoke when he met with chairmen of 13 council areas, 64 coordinators of development centres, liaison officers and committee members of development centres including senior technical assistants, in Abakaliki.

He explained that areas of concentration would be on poultry, rice farming and cassava production.

He stressed that modern cassava processing plants would be establish in threesenatorial zones of the state, thereafter to 13 local government areas of the state.

"We intend to have one cassava processing plants in each senatorial zone of the state and as soon as we are through with that we will stepdown to each local government areas which will come in phase 2 of the programme.

"So we are looking for those who are suppose to say either as a person or group to say l want to manage this cassava plant.

"And as you are working you will pay back to government and we will put mechanism down to make sure that it is not abuse.
